Abstract

This chapter explores the critical role of biorecognition elements in biosensor development, emphasizing their selectivity and sensitivity. It delves into the advancements and challenges in creating robust affinity-based methods for analytical detection. The text covers a wide range of biorecognition elements, including aptamers, phages, and molecularly imprinted polymers, highlighting their unique advantages and applications. It also discusses the use of recombinant DNA technology and genetically modified cells in biosensor development. The chapter concludes with an overview of the potential of these elements in enhancing the sensitivity, specificity, and robustness of biosensors, making them invaluable tools for various applications in biotechnology, medical diagnostics, and environmental monitoring.
